Health Technical Memorandum 00: Policies and principles of healthcare engineering
Health Technical Memorandum 00 (HTM 00), 2014 edition, is the foundational document of the Health Technical Memorandum suite issued by the Department of Health in England. It establishes the core engineering principles for the design, installation, and operation of specialized building and engineering technology within the healthcare estate. As a statute-aligned guidance document, it operates under the wider legal framework of the Health and Social Care Act 2008 and the Health and Safety at Work etc Act 1974, providing a basis for demonstrating duty of care and regulatory compliance.
The scope of this memorandum encompasses the entire building lifecycle, from concept and procurement to maintenance and eventual disposal. It governs a range of regulatory domains including infection prevention and control, fire safety, and utility management. The document is structured into seven primary chapters and two appendices, defining a professional structure of roles such as the Designated Person and Authorising Engineer. It serves as the primary reference for estates and facilities professionals to ensure the resilience of business-critical systems supporting direct patient care.
The following sections detail the management structures, technical requirements, and maintenance protocols required to satisfy both clinical safety standards and national regulatory expectations for healthcare facilities.
Policy and Regulatory Overview
Healthcare organisations are assessed against legal requirements and standards set by the Care Quality Commission (CQC). Compliance with HTM 00 is used as evidence towards meeting registration requirements concerning the safety and suitability of premises and equipment.
- NHS Premises Assurance Model (NHS PAM): A universal model used to provide governance and assurance to boards regarding the safety and effectiveness of the healthcare environment.
- Climate Change Act: Requirements for both Mitigation (lowering carbon emissions and water consumption) and Adaptation (minimising effects of flooding, drought, and heatwaves).
- Health and Safety Legislation: Legal duties are placed on dutyholders under regulations including the Workplace (Health, Safety and Welfare) Regulations and the Construction (Design and Management) (CDM) Regulations.
Professional Support and Responsibility Structure
The document defines a formal professional structure to ensure engineering governance and the safe operation of specialist services. This hierarchy establishes clear lines of accountability from the board level to technical staff.
- Designated Person (DP): An appointed senior executive at the board level with assigned responsibility for a specific service.
- Authorising Engineer (AE): An independent professional engineer who acts as an assessor, monitors service performance, and provides annual audits to the DP.
- Authorised Person (AP): The individual with key operational responsibility for a specialist service, possessing the necessary qualifications and skills to operate the system.
- Competent Person (CP): A skilled craftsperson or contractor who performs installation and maintenance work under the direction of the AP.
Design and Installation Principles
Engineering services must support a healing environment while ensuring patient safety through system resilience and reliability. Design considerations must account for peak maximum loads and include allowances for future expansion.
- Infection Prevention and Control: Engineering services must incorporate smooth, accessible surfaces that are easy to wipe clean. Ventilation must maintain specific pressure differentials, and water systems must mitigate the risk of Legionella and Pseudomonas aeruginosa.
- Mechanical Services: Radiator surface temperatures must not exceed 43ºC. Piped medical gases must comply with HTM 02-01, and specialized ventilation systems must follow HTM 03-01.
- Electrical Services: Infrastructure must meet the requirements of the IEE Wiring Regulations BS7671. Lighting design should prioritise natural daylight and energy-efficient LED sources where appropriate.
Maintenance and Risk Management
Healthcare organisations must establish a maintenance policy and asset management strategy to ensure equipment is regularly inspected. The document advocates for a balance between Planned Maintenance (PM) and reactive repair.
- Evaluation Matrix: A 5x5 matrix is used to map the probability of an event against the severity of the effect, ranging from Insignificant to Catastrophic.
- Confined Spaces: A permit-to-work procedure must be established for work in confined spaces, including air quality testing and rescue plans.
- Record Keeping: Accurate as-fitted drawings, manuals, and asset records must be maintained in an accessible format, often utilising Building Information Modelling (BIM) and COBie data exchange.

What is the maximum allowable surface temperature for radiators in healthcare settings?
The surface temperature of radiators should not exceed 43ºC to protect vulnerable patients from thermal injury.
What is the difference between an Authorised Person and an Authorising Engineer?
An Authorised Person has direct operational responsibility for a specialist service, while an Authorising Engineer is an independent professional who audits the service and recommends the appointment of Authorised Persons.

What is COBie in the context of healthcare engineering?
COBie (Construction Operations Building information exchange) is the standard format for sharing non-graphical information about a building asset as part of the BIM process.
Are healthcare providers required to have a lockdown capability?
Yes, as category 1 responders under the Civil Contingencies Act 2004, healthcare organisations must have the ability to lock down their sites or buildings.
